CARY, N.C. (WTVD) -- The Lucy Daniels Center is expanding its footprint in the Triangle. The nonprofit received about $900,000 in federal funding for the multi-million-dollar expansion project, which will nearly triple the nonprofit's size.
The goal is for families to have one place to meet multiple needs when it comes to mental health .
"Clinicians have a chance to come here and train here and learn how to do this kind of in-depth, thoughtful work with young children," said Lucy Daniels Center Executive Director Emily Odjaghian.
"(I'm) not just proud, but surprised," said Founder Lucy Daniels. "It's really amazing and I'm glad I did it, but I was thinking about individual children. I didn't know it would become a big thing like this."
